Roadside barriers and bridge rails are typically close sufficient to the travelled method that they can be splashed with water from passing web traffic. In a lot of components of the nation this water consists of visit their website deicing chemicals throughout winter season months - Crash Beams. In seaside places in warmer environments the salt filled air down payments destructive chemicals on obstacles


When subjected to these atmospheres, weathering steel never creates the 'patina' that slows corrosion as in other much less hostile settings. Within a couple of years considerable section loss may result. The inside of box light beam obstacles and the lap splice of w-beams can rust rapidly to the point where the obstacle might end up being much more hazardous than the feature it was suggested to secure.


Some Known Details About Crash Beams


One accommodation that has actually been tried is using zinc aluminum foil at the w-beam overlap where the zinc's galvanic action reduces the rust. Usage of thicker sections (aside from the terminal) might likewise lengthen the life, however upkeep ought to still consist of evaluation of the areas and joints. The Jacket- and F-shape barriers are both "safety-shape" barriers that use this link start with a 3 inch upright face at the pavement degree. After that they break to a sloped face that goes up to 13 inches over the sidewalk on the Jersey obstacle, however only up to an elevation of 10 inches when it comes to the F-Shape.


The Texas Constant-Slope Obstacle is 1070 mm (42 in) high and has a constant-slope face that makes an angle of 10. The crash tests show that the performance of the Texas Constant-Slope Barrier is equivalent to that of the Jersey-shape and the performance of the California Single-Slope Obstacle is equivalent to that of the F-shape.

In low rate impacts this might cause the car's redirection without sheet steel contact with the face of the concrete wall surface. In medium speed influences there will certainly be damage to the automobile yet the residents will certainly experience minimal forces. In high speed influences to safety shaped wall surfaces there will certainly be significant car damage and small to modest injury potential to the residents.
